logo

DeepSeek本地+云端部署知识库智能体满血版:全场景覆盖的智能进化之路

作者:php是最好的2025.09.25 21:29浏览量:0

简介:本文深入解析DeepSeek知识库智能体在本地与云端混合部署中的技术实现、架构设计及优化策略,通过实际案例与代码示例,为开发者提供从环境配置到性能调优的全流程指导。

一、混合部署架构的核心价值与技术演进

1.1 本地化部署的刚性需求与云端弹性的互补性

在金融、医疗等强监管行业,数据主权与隐私合规要求企业必须将核心知识库部署在本地环境。例如某三甲医院在实施电子病历智能检索系统时,需确保患者信息不离开医院内网。而云端部署则可提供弹性算力支持,当系统面临突发性查询高峰(如疫情期间在线问诊量激增)时,可快速扩展实例应对压力。

技术演进路径显示,从纯本地部署到混合架构的转变经历了三个阶段:

  • 物理机时代:单机存储+定时同步,存在数据延迟问题
  • 容器化阶段:Kubernetes实现跨机房资源调度,但运维复杂度高
  • 智能体融合架构:通过联邦学习实现模型参数的双向同步,保持本地模型与云端大模型的协同进化

1.2 满血版架构的三大技术突破

  1. 动态知识路由:基于查询特征的智能分流系统,将结构化查询导向本地知识图谱,复杂语义分析交由云端大模型处理。测试数据显示该机制使平均响应时间降低42%
  2. 增量式知识更新:采用差分压缩算法,仅传输知识变更部分,云端到本地的同步带宽占用减少78%
  3. 多模态知识融合:支持文本、图像、视频的跨模态检索,本地部署轻量化特征提取模型,云端完成跨模态关联分析

二、本地部署实施指南

2.1 硬件选型与性能优化

  • CPU架构选择:推荐使用支持AVX-512指令集的Intel Xeon Platinum系列,在向量检索场景下性能提升30%
  • 内存配置策略:知识库索引阶段建议配置DDR5 ECC内存,容量按每TB数据48GB内存计算
  • 存储加速方案:采用Intel Optane持久化内存作为热数据缓存层,随机读取IOPS可达500K

2.2 容器化部署实践

  1. # 示例:DeepSeek知识库服务Dockerfile
  2. FROM nvidia/cuda:11.8.0-base-ubuntu22.04
  3. RUN apt-get update && apt-get install -y \
  4. python3.10 \
  5. python3-pip \
  6. libopenblas-dev
  7. WORKDIR /app
  8. COPY requirements.txt .
  9. RUN pip install --no-cache-dir -r requirements.txt
  10. COPY ./src ./src
  11. CMD ["gunicorn", "--bind", "0.0.0.0:8000", "src.main:app"]

关键配置参数:

  • GPU内存限制:--gpus all --memory 16g
  • 线程数设置:--threads 4(根据CPU核心数调整)
  • 日志轮转:配置logrotate实现按日期分割日志

2.3 安全加固方案

实施三层次防护体系:

  1. 传输层:强制启用TLS 1.3,禁用弱密码套件
  2. 应用层:实现基于JWT的API令牌认证,设置30分钟有效期
  3. 数据层:采用AES-256-GCM加密存储,密钥管理使用HSM硬件模块

三、云端协同架构设计

3.1 弹性伸缩策略

基于Prometheus监控指标的自动扩缩容规则:

  1. # 云服务商自动扩缩组配置示例
  2. scaleOut:
  3. metric: cpu_utilization
  4. threshold: 75%
  5. cooldown: 300s
  6. scaleIn:
  7. metric: request_latency
  8. threshold: 500ms
  9. minInstances: 2

3.2 混合训练框架

联邦学习实现流程:

  1. 本地节点执行前向传播,计算梯度
  2. 通过安全聚合协议加密上传梯度
  3. 云端参数服务器执行全局模型更新
  4. 下发差分更新包至本地节点

实验数据显示,在10个本地节点参与训练时,模型收敛速度较集中式训练仅下降12%,但数据隐私得到完全保障。

3.3 灾备方案设计

实施两地三中心架构:

  • 生产中心:承载主要业务流量
  • 同城灾备:50公里内,RTO<15分钟
  • 异地灾备:500公里外,RPO<1小时

采用持续数据保护(CDP)技术,实现秒级数据快照,配合Kubernetes的集群联邦功能实现应用层故障自动转移。

四、性能调优实战

4.1 查询延迟优化

通过火焰图分析定位性能瓶颈,典型优化案例:

  • 索引结构优化:将倒排索引改为HNSW图索引,千万级数据查询从800ms降至120ms
  • 缓存策略调整:实现三级缓存体系(内存>SSD>磁盘),热点数据命中率提升至92%
  • 并行化改造:将串行检索流程改为流水线处理,吞吐量提升3倍

4.2 资源利用率提升

GPU共享技术实现方案:

  1. # 示例:基于MPS的GPU共享配置
  2. def configure_mps():
  3. os.system("nvidia-cuda-mps-control -d")
  4. os.system("echo 'server_launch_timeout 300' > /tmp/nvidia-mps/server.log")
  5. # 设置每个容器最大使用40%GPU资源
  6. os.environ["NVIDIA_VISIBLE_DEVICES"] = "0"
  7. os.environ["NVIDIA_MPS_MAX_CLIENTS"] = "5"

4.3 监控告警体系

构建包含200+监控项的指标体系,重点指标包括:

  • 知识库更新延迟(P99<5分钟)
  • 查询成功率(>99.9%)
  • 模型推理耗时(P50<200ms)

设置智能告警阈值,例如当连续5个采样点查询延迟超过阈值时触发一级告警。

五、行业应用案例

5.1 智能制造知识中枢

某汽车集团部署方案:

  • 本地部署:产线设备知识库(300万条故障码)
  • 云端部署:设计规范知识库(50万份技术文档)
  • 混合查询:通过自然语言提问”如何处理E1023故障码对应的变速箱问题”,系统自动关联设计文档中的扭矩参数要求

实施效果:设备故障诊断时间从2.4小时缩短至18分钟,年减少停机损失超2000万元。

5.2 智慧城市大脑

某省级政务平台实践:

  • 本地节点:部署在各市政务云,存储敏感数据
  • 云端节点:省级平台处理跨域查询
  • 创新点:实现”数据不出域,知识可共享”的联邦查询机制

系统上线后,跨部门业务办理时长压缩67%,群众满意度提升至98.3分。

六、未来演进方向

6.1 边缘计算融合

计划在5G基站侧部署轻量化知识推理节点,实现:

  • 实时路况分析延迟<50ms
  • 工业视觉检测吞吐量>1000帧/秒
  • 边缘节点自治能力(断网持续运行72小时)

6.2 量子增强架构

研究量子随机数生成器在知识加密中的应用,初步实验显示:

  • 加密强度提升10^15倍
  • 密钥分发效率提高40%
  • 兼容现有TLS协议栈

6.3 自主进化系统

构建基于强化学习的知识库优化引擎,通过持续交互实现:

  • 查询意图理解准确率自动提升
  • 知识关联规则动态发现
  • 资源分配策略自我调整

结语:DeepSeek本地+云端部署知识库智能体满血版代表着企业知识管理的新范式,其混合架构设计既满足了合规性要求,又释放了云计算的弹性价值。通过持续的技术创新,该方案正在重塑知识获取与利用的边界,为数字化转型提供坚实的智能基础设施。

相关文章推荐

发表评论

活动